Transaction 73526170eadeeb28ca86220742fcb5dc8d7a9540dd261fc0ddc8817c62aeaab8
1 Input
1 Output
-
73526170eadeeb28ca86220742fcb5dc8d7a9540dd261fc0ddc8817c62aeaab8:0
- value
- 882758
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32d1e3e847d605260b1cce472d93216bde53a63 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MiCSQieFFi2j1Y1iXV2CgMMBQhDr6pX4f